Get A QuoteJan 05, 2022 · Sizing the Boiler. Steam systems are sized according to the connected load. To size the steam space heating boiler, all the heat emitters should be totaled, and about 10%-20% is added to cover the piping. When sizing the steam boiler for a brewery, it becomes more complicated. An undersized boiler will not meet the brewer's requirements.
Get A QuoteFeb 21, 2019 · Sizing the boiler. The most important part of the steam system design is to properly size the boiler. An oversized boiler can result in frequent cycling, while an undersized boiler may never be able to meet the temperature requirements of the brewery. Either circumstance will adversely affect the brewing process.

Get A QuoteMar 17, 2015 · Steam, Boiler, and Blowdown Pressure are the same. Combustion Efficiency is the % of fuel energy that is directly added to the feedwater and not otherwise lost or used. Blowdown Rate is the % of incoming feedwater mass flow rate that leaves the boiler as a saturated liquid at boiler pressure.

Get A QuoteBoiler Horsepower Calculator. Boiler horsepower is used for sizing steam boilers. This calculation translates the steam load (in pounds per hour) to boiler horsepower. Each boiler is given a boiler horsepower (BHP) rating based on the steam output capacity at 212°F and 0 psig.

Get A QuoteBoiler Sizing Matt, I generally size 1 BHP (boiler horse power) per barrel of brewhouse capacity for our brewpub systems. You can get away with less, but a lot depends on how close the boiler is to the brewhouse, hot liquor tank usage, steam pressure and the size of the steam supply line. Your 4 HP boiler is small for a 10 bbl kettle.
